Sunday, 16 March 2008

Rothmans MkIIStoneleigh Park in Coventry played host to RACE RETRO, the 5th International Historic Motorsport Show 2008.  Welcoming almost 25,000 visitors which was 20% up on last year's attendance.

The event is Europe's premier show of it's type incorporating classic competition cars, bikes & Karts from the road, off road & on track disciplines.

"We're delighted with this evidence of the show's growing popularity, particularly in the current tough market," said Event Director Ian Williamson.

As well as numerous hall's full of exhibitors & a Bonhams auction is the ever popular live events which include the crowd pulling 'Rally Stage In The Park'.

The stage attracted a number of celebrity drivers & co-drivers this year with the likes of Markku Alen, Russell Brooks, Pentti Arrikala, Bjorn Waldergard & Tony Mason featuring in the group B cars brought to the show by the Slowly Sideways Group GB .

The threequarter-mile Tarmac track was the setting for some of the most iconic machinery from the golden age of rallying. Cars featured were the Audi E2 Quattro, MG Metro 6R4, Renualt Maxi Turbo's, Ford RS200's, Peugeot 205 & 405 T16's, Opel Manta 400's & an ex-works LANCIA 037 Rallye in the Martini colours. Add the ever present Ford Escort Mk I & II's to the mix & the stage was complete.

The Group B cars banned just over 20 years ago after a series of accidents took you back to a place when the 'Mickey Mouse' stages were a casual spectators dream of the RAC Rally's of days gone & as the heavens opened on the Saturday afternoon everybody watching & competing were taken back to the late 70's & early 80's once more.

With a mix of displays and trade stands there was something for everyone "Our 440 exhibitors rose to the occasion," concludes Event Director Ian Williamson, "with unprecedented standards of presentation and outstanding exhibits. We were thrilled to see so many enthusiastic visitors and we're already looking forward to next year's show."
